This work is a collection of memoirs from an officer who served in the Caucasus. The book immerses the reader in the atmosphere of the time, describing the daily life, customs, and significant events of the region. The author shares personal impressions and observations captured in his notes. The text conveys a unique perspective on life in the Caucasian region through the eyes of someone directly involved in its history.
